Akureyri

Akureyri is the largest town in the northern region of Iceland, and is often considered the unofficial capital of the north. The town is a popular fishing port and is often used as a basecamp for visiting the more rural surrounding area. Akureyri is known for their great art scene, beautiful architecture, and stunning natural scenery.

Aveiro

Aveiro has great canals that are lined by houses. Because of this ambiance, the town has earned its nickname the "Portuguese Venice." While it's similar, don't put too much into the name. The town is also known for it's colorful boats, referred to as moliceiros, that ride along the canals and under the bridges.

While the canals are lovely, most visitors actually come for the beaches. Aveiro's beaches are known for their clean and pristine sand. The shore is referred to as the Silver Coast, and has comfortably warm water, which is another major draw to the area.

Aveiro is comfortable year around because it's winters are mild and warm and its summer is somewhat cool. The winter months get the most rain and the summer is usually the driest. If you're there during the fall and winter, the winds will be strong making it the best time for surfing, sailing, and other water sports.

Which place is cheaper, Aveiro or Akureyri?

These are the overall average travel costs for the two destinations. These travel costs come from the actual spending of real travelers.

The average daily cost (per person) in Akureyri is $188, while the average daily cost in Aveiro is $114. These costs include accommodation (assuming double occupancy, so the traveler is sharing the room), food, transportation, and entertainment. While every person is different, these costs are an average of past travelers in each destination. What follows is a categorical breakdown of travel costs for Akureyri and Aveiro in more detail.

When is the best time to visit Akureyri or Aveiro?

Both places have a temperate climate with four distinct seasons. As both cities are in the northern hemisphere, summer is in July and winter is in January.

Should I visit Akureyri or Aveiro in the Summer?

Both Aveiro and Akureyri during the summer are popular places to visit.

In July, Akureyri is generally much colder than Aveiro. Daily temperatures in Akureyri average around 11°C (52°F), and Aveiro fluctuates around 21°C (69°F).

In Aveiro, it's very sunny this time of the year. In the summer, Akureyri often gets less sunshine than Aveiro. Akureyri gets 158 hours of sunny skies this time of year, while Aveiro receives 308 hours of full sun.

Akureyri usually gets more rain in July than Aveiro. Akureyri gets 33 mm (1.3 in) of rain, while Aveiro receives 16 mm (0.6 in) of rain this time of the year.


  • Summer Average Temperatures July
    Akureyri 11°C (52°F) 
    Aveiro 21°C (69°F)

Should I visit Akureyri or Aveiro in the Autumn?

The autumn attracts plenty of travelers to both Akureyri and Aveiro.

Akureyri can get quite cold in the autumn. Akureyri is much colder than Aveiro in the autumn. The daily temperature in Akureyri averages around 3°C (38°F) in October, and Aveiro fluctuates around 17°C (62°F).

Akureyri usually receives less sunshine than Aveiro during autumn. Akureyri gets 52 hours of sunny skies, while Aveiro receives 184 hours of full sun in the autumn.

Aveiro receives a lot of rain in the autumn. In October, Akureyri usually receives less rain than Aveiro. Akureyri gets 58 mm (2.3 in) of rain, while Aveiro receives 131 mm (5.2 in) of rain each month for the autumn.


  • Autumn Average Temperatures October
    Akureyri 3°C (38°F) 
    Aveiro 17°C (62°F)

Should I visit Akureyri or Aveiro in the Winter?

The winter brings many poeple to Akureyri as well as Aveiro.

Akureyri can be very cold during winter. In the winter, Akureyri is much colder than Aveiro. Typically, the winter temperatures in Akureyri in January average around -2°C (28°F), and Aveiro averages at about 10°C (50°F).

In the winter, Akureyri often gets less sunshine than Aveiro. Akureyri gets 7 hours of sunny skies this time of year, while Aveiro receives 124 hours of full sun.

It's quite rainy in Aveiro. Akureyri usually gets less rain in January than Aveiro. Akureyri gets 55 mm (2.2 in) of rain, while Aveiro receives 171 mm (6.7 in) of rain this time of the year.


  • Winter Average Temperatures January
    Akureyri -2°C (28°F) 
    Aveiro 10°C (50°F)

Should I visit Akureyri or Aveiro in the Spring?

Both Aveiro and Akureyri are popular destinations to visit in the spring with plenty of activities.

The weather in Akureyri can be very cold. In April, Akureyri is generally much colder than Aveiro. Daily temperatures in Akureyri average around 2°C (36°F), and Aveiro fluctuates around 14°C (56°F).

It's quite sunny in Aveiro. Akureyri usually receives less sunshine than Aveiro during spring. Akureyri gets 130 hours of sunny skies, while Aveiro receives 217 hours of full sun in the spring.

It rains a lot this time of the year in Aveiro. In April, Akureyri usually receives less rain than Aveiro. Akureyri gets 29 mm (1.1 in) of rain, while Aveiro receives 112 mm (4.4 in) of rain each month for the spring.


  • Spring Average Temperatures April
    Akureyri 2°C (36°F) 
    Aveiro 14°C (56°F)

Typical Weather for Aveiro and Akureyri

Akureyri Aveiro
Temp (°C) Rain (mm) Temp (°C) Rain (mm)
Jan -2°C (28°F) 55 mm (2.2 in) 10°C (50°F) 171 mm (6.7 in)
Feb -1°C (30°F) 43 mm (1.7 in) 11°C (51°F) 169 mm (6.7 in)
Mar -1°C (31°F) 43 mm (1.7 in) 12°C (54°F) 112 mm (4.4 in)
Apr 2°C (36°F) 29 mm (1.1 in) 14°C (56°F) 112 mm (4.4 in)
May 6°C (43°F) 19 mm (0.8 in) 16°C (60°F) 89 mm (3.5 in)
Jun 10°C (50°F) 28 mm (1.1 in) 19°C (66°F) 53 mm (2.1 in)
Jul 11°C (52°F) 33 mm (1.3 in) 21°C (69°F) 16 mm (0.6 in)
Aug 11°C (51°F) 34 mm (1.3 in) 20°C (69°F) 22 mm (0.9 in)
Sep 7°C (44°F) 39 mm (1.5 in) 20°C (67°F) 64 mm (2.5 in)
Oct 3°C (38°F) 58 mm (2.3 in) 17°C (62°F) 131 mm (5.2 in)
Nov -0°C (32°F) 54 mm (2.1 in) 13°C (55°F) 152 mm (6 in)
Dec -2°C (29°F) 53 mm (2.1 in) 11°C (51°F) 176 mm (6.9 in)
